As train approaches, bystanders leap onto tracks to assist man

Horror, then help at Andrew Station

She noticed nothing unusual until she heard a thump, and the man with a large duffle bag was no longer standing on the platform. He had fallen on the train tracks and become unconscious, and all Mimi T. Lai could do was look for help. (Full article: 364 words)
